Emil Naepflein wrote:
> 
> On Fri, 19 Oct 2001 09:58:20 +0200, Klaus Schmidinger
> <Klaus.Schmidinger@cadsoft.de> wrote:
> 
> > I believe switching the primary interface is good enough.
> > If you really want to control both cards independently from each other,
> > why don't you run seperate instances of VDR for each card (using the '-D'
> > and '-c' options)?
> 
> Because then you loose the advantage of a second card for recording and
> timeshifting. :)
> 
> You know, we always find a hair in the soup. ;-)
> 
> I actually have a 4 DVB system and sometimes would like to set the
> channel or start a replay on annother card for a second viewer. I
> actually could feed two channels with the Conrad modulator into my
> distribution network.
> 
> But in my case better would be to have multiple *primary* interfaces
> with independent OSDs running. A real multiuser VDR. ;-)

As the name indicates: "There can be only ONE!" If we have a PRIMARY
interface, how can there be a "second primary interface"?

> BTW, what happens when I start a replay and change the primary?
> Is the replay stopped or does it continue?
> I will try it when I am at home.

Starting a replay on a non-primary card is something that has yet to
be implemented. Currently it won't really work too good.
